In the context of mobile device repair, the iKey Tools X4 is a significant software release designed for advanced iOS servicing. It is primarily used for iCloud Activation Lock bypass on compatible iPhone and iPad models. Key Features:
Untethered Bypass: Unlike tethered solutions, this tool allows devices to remain bypassed even after a restart.
Full Service Support: Recent versions (X4) focus on fixing common bypass issues, such as restoring cellular signal/calls, enabling iCloud sign-in, and ensuring notifications function correctly.
Device Compatibility: It is often utilized for older hardware (like the iPhone X and earlier) that relies on specific exploits like checkm8 to gain the necessary system access. 2. Automotive Key Programming (KEYDIY KD-X4) and J1850) simultaneously
In the automotive locksmithing world, the KD-X4 is a mobile-integrated hardware tool from KEYDIY used to generate and program car remotes and transponders. Key Features:
Transponder Generation: It can clone and generate various transponder chips, including advanced systems like the Volkswagen MQB immobilizer.
Dealer Key Generation: Locksmiths use it to read chip data and generate "dealer-ready" keys by syncing with cloud databases.
Bluetooth Connectivity: The device typically connects to a smartphone via Bluetooth, allowing users to control the generation process through the KEYDIY mobile app.
Success with Modern Systems: It has been noted for successfully adding spare keys to newer vehicles like the 2021 VW ID.4 without requiring complex SFD (Vehicle Diagnostic Protection) unlocks in some cases. The iKey Tool x4 is a multi-brand automotive diagnostic and key programming device. Unlike universal scanners that focus on engine diagnostics, the iKey Tool x4 specializes in immobilizer systems, transponder programming, remote generation, and ECU (Engine Control Unit) coding.
